Hi all,

I have a Mac Pro 5,1 running OpenCore patched Monterey. My machine is detecting my RX580 as having 7MB of vRAM and no kexts. Any ideas?

I've tried:
- Swapping slots
- Rebuilding OC
- Making sure it works in a PC
- Tried in High Sierra, detects 8GB no issue and works smoothly
- Reinstalling Monterey
- Different display cables

I've been researching for ~2 hours and I can't seem to see where the shortfall is.. :(

Specs:
Mid 2012 Server, 2x 3.46GHz, 64GB RAM, AMD Radeon Sapphire RX580 Pulse, 500GB SATA SSD

Attached is a screenshot from System Information
